7 hours ago, mrlevin said:

We are on 14 November and no letter and no change to cruise planner.  Question for those that have gotten notified - have your prepaid excursions for Cayman Islands and Jamaica been automatically refunded to credit card that was used to purchase?

 

Marc

Yes, according to my itinerary change email:

 

Our Shore Excursions team will automatically reschedule any pre-paid Royal Caribbean International shore excursions booked for Cozumel. Any pre-paid Royal Caribbean International shore excursions booked for Grand Cayman and Jamaica will automatically be refunded to your original form of payment.
